Received: by 10.223.176.5 with SMTP id f5csp1227998wra; Wed, 31 Jan 2018 03:18:07 -0800 (PST) X-Google-Smtp-Source: AH8x224rqaeFo+NWKndMwogP+NRHGVdVzJK3Cb8Orf4WUiAtzwo8HhQIlwsRkHm7qmS4q6CaqIiM X-Received: by 2002:a17:902:7f0b:: with SMTP id d11-v6mr9452262plm.350.1517397487147; Wed, 31 Jan 2018 03:18:07 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1517397487; cv=none; d=google.com; s=arc-20160816; b=hPhK8R/ziTConGnTN+5W7kV059R4eoWTrX7feSCdHL2MNwNhD1ITm8xIdfWiQRnUGx EbtWm1OwZp8L73mnDAVfEcnCbd+JXaO+guqkC12tFs2S36GcQnhqgmO7n+XyZqZR0rsG UcMTEqX8jmI+fdn4jG+e1o4qTNYwanC05GG2FH3958MF0HUgTPwUmYVYEaEmu+lJ2BOu gx6rMX7p8XLznf6bnIl9Gs8xNYGjz1Kg0Wr0qbz9OrEph/0+i7/QNP4JUJoZ97Ym/dCI n6bJoLcFd/R2K2orFaxmX4dUAswZ9ftvMU/JValNzBKyiwWV0L/xqGO44UBFxKToc43v 5/jg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ding:mime-version :organization:references:in-reply-to:date:cc:to:reply-to:from :subject:message-id:arc-authentication-results; bh=FDzkP+KHKWHtpjtQfsPs1gKbtD0Iw5cqpittvEtoqpM=; b=Xt7KrBnfmVCesVqywQ94tlblPoVCvdSw1zRgRfrGAvrDh0XdsLiA3sLtxofHGX7Tvp LTnzJdw4kD3FiM+PC4CShYOPNIFFxLqGOEjRPES3bqGR5wr14PoFHcpHHQPZr1YTcJA+ R+leZN5TJ24W/qEiF9UZ+18b3T/8nQNIrt9WkIAq5oFR6mrNF2mJLcRMmYYNpVVcoRG5 iThf5LoKIyQQq9aSEhDs7WPNK70PfiYvR8qsFZzwlWdyvgk4dVoSv3kpI6flh2GfRQuM 52+PNKUa7d7EERIkmuwXlv0svbv6O0d3YNQl+Jdsm42vyCxsPTTdpoYdSW8TRF6W/zzQ 8x9g==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=redhat.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id bd8-v6si1891105plb.3.2018.01.31.03.17.52; Wed, 31 Jan 2018 03:18:07 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=redhat.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752853AbeAaLQz (ORCPT + 99 others); Wed, 31 Jan 2018 06:16:55 -0500 Received: from mx1.redhat.com ([209.132.183.28]:57906 "EHLO mx1.redhat.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751756AbeAaLQy (ORCPT ); Wed, 31 Jan 2018 06:16:54 -0500 Received: from smtp.corp.redhat.com (int-mx01.intmail.prod.int.phx2.redhat.com [10.5.11.11]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by mx1.redhat.com (Postfix) with ESMTPS id 44018800A4; Wed, 31 Jan 2018 11:16:54 +0000 (UTC) Received: from ovpn-204-191.brq.redhat.com (ovpn-204-191.brq.redhat.com [10.40.204.191]) by smtp.corp.redhat.com (Postfix) with ESMTP id 2517B600D5; Wed, 31 Jan 2018 11:16:49 +0000 (UTC) Message-ID: <1517397409.3452.7.camel@redhat.com> Subject: Re: [RFC PATCH 1/2] hv_netvsc: Split netvsc_revoke_buf() and netvsc_teardown_gpadl() From: Mohammed Gamal Reply-To: mgamal@redhat.com To: Stephen Hemminger Cc: netdev@vger.kernel.org, otubo@redhat.com, sthemmin@microsoft.com, haiyangz@microsoft.com, linux-kernel@vger.kernel.org, devel@linuxdriverproject.org, vkuznets@redhat.com Date: Wed, 31 Jan 2018 12:16:49 +0100 In-Reply-To: <20180130112926.53f3c166@xeon-e3> References: <1516700045-32142-1-git-send-email-mgamal@redhat.com> <1516700045-32142-2-git-send-email-mgamal@redhat.com> <20180130112926.53f3c166@xeon-e3> Organization: Red Hat Content-Type: text/plain; charset="UTF-8" Mime-Version: 1.0 Content-Transfer-Encoding: 7bit X-Scanned-By: MIMEDefang 2.79 on 10.5.11.11 X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.5.16 (mx1.redhat.com [10.5.110.28]); Wed, 31 Jan 2018 11:16:54 +0000 (UTC)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Tue, 2018-01-30 at 11:29 -0800, Stephen Hemminger wrote: > On Tue, 23 Jan 2018 10:34:04 +0100 > Mohammed Gamal wrote: > > > Split each of the functions into two for each of send/recv buffers > > > > Signed-off-by: Mohammed Gamal > > Splitting these functions is not necessary How so? We need to send each message independently, and hence the split (see cover letter). Is there another way?